- [ ] Heads up, newcomers: the Gildhall seat-map renderer caches its signed layout bundle, so before we rotate the Lanternview theatre's rendering key, flush the bundle cache and confirm the orchestra-level map redraws cleanly. If rows A through F show up without gaps, you're good. Seal the retired key in the ceremony envelope and record the passphrase directly beneath this item.

recovery phrase for yahag-yagap: pramir-normir-norius-kasax

This alert fires when GC pauses in the Pairwise matching service exceed 800ms over a five-minute window. Usually it's a heap misconfig after a deploy, not real load. Check the Matchline dashboard first, then restart the worker pool if pauses persist. If you're stuck, ping the platform crew.

escalation mailbox, bafog-fafog: ulador@paliqlabs.internal

**Action item 7 (owner: on-call rotation).** During the Kestrel Bay Marathon outage, the Fleetmark chip readers dropped reads whenever runner density exceeded roughly 40 crossings per second, because the dedupe window and antenna poll interval were tuned for training events, not race day. We must pin the race-day profile in config rather than relying on the auto-tuner, and document the rationale inline. The values we validated post-incident are recorded below.

constants for yawig-fahif:
RATE_LIMITS = {
    "wenath": 5,
    "oliwyn": 10,
    "ralael": 5,
    "druix": 10,
}

## Configuration

Swiftmason handles incremental rebuilds for static sites hosted on the Lanternpost platform. When a content editor saves a page, only the affected routes are regenerated, which keeps rebuild times under a minute for most customers. Support staff reproducing rebuild issues locally need a working .env file in the repo root. Copy .env.example to .env and review the cache and concurrency settings. The rebuild webhook will reject all requests until the signing credential is set, so add the following line:

env line for fafof-fahag: LEDGER_TOKEN5=f8790